Lucy is turning 8 and so she now requires some additional comfort in life as she approaches her mature years, and also getting some old people issues that prevent her from jumping on and off the sofas anymore. That also means that we've gone through so many beds in the past 8 years that I've realized a few things are important to her: 1) She loves pillows, so she needed a bed that had the side bolsters. I've searched and wasted money on SOO many other beds that look fluffy and end up flatting out when she tries to lay on them. I feel like I FINALLY found a bed with real filling that is actually supportive. You can see in the images that they actually hold up against her weight when she rests her head on them. I think this is the #1 reason she loves this bed so much. The arms are real pillows. 2) The bed itself had to have true thickness and orthopedic quality to support her weight and back. Corgis tend to be prone to developing back issues late in life, so it's important to me that she have support to prevent these from developing. This mattress is thick and truly orthopedic. She actually prefers this bed now to other furniture and I think that this is the main reason why. She's finally comfortable in her older age. For this reason I just ordered a second one to replace the bedroom doggie bed. She'll now have one in the living room and in the bedroom. Totally worth it! 3) Lucy sheds a ton and loves to chew her toys on her beds so it had to be washable and vacuum-friendly. The cover is easy to unzip and slip on and off for washing. Lucy isn't that harsh on her beds so I haven't run into the trouble that some other reviewers have. I also keep a blanket on it for her (as you can see in the pictures), which might also be protecting the cover from wearing down quickly. However, in my honest opinion, even if this cover wears out, that's still worth it to me. The covers aren't that expensive, can be purchased separately, and the bed itself is good quality so I know that it'll definitely last through the next cover. The mattress and bolsters quality is key for me. Additionally, I vacuum it almost daily and it hasn't had any wear and tear signs yet between the washing and vacuuming. I'll provide an update if that changes. I've only had it for about 4 months now, so maybe it's still too new for what others have noted? Finally, I can't speak to the waterproof issue that some others have noted in their reviews. Again, Lucy just sleeps on her beds for the most part, and doesn't ever soil them so I have no idea if it is or isn't waterproof. But, I did follow someone's advice and bought a crib mattress cover to wrap the bottom mattress in before putting it into the vinyl sleeve provided (just in case). Something to consider.
